Now you can customize the background of your logon screen and even change it every day with the help of a free application called Windows 7 Logon Background Changer.

Here’s how the application looks like once you’ve open it.

Select through the standard Windows backgrounds on the thumbnails at the top portion. If you don’t like the default backgrounds, click on “Choose a folder” and browse through the folders where you saved the pictures you want.

Once you have decided on which picture to use, click on Apply. The application will then ask for your authorization to change the background of the logon screen, select Yes.

If the User Account Control is not disabled, it will pop up and prompts you; click on Yes and you’re all set.

You may want to log off and see the changes for yourself.
If you changed the default folder and want to set it back or adjust the text on the logon screen for better viewing, click on Settings.
